Output 57c46941f81c46a0f1519cff5243c61eb252e91e5dd78a5d54dfbac3304e86ba:0

value
2276696724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cb663e9c5c023ba498ccd7310567de311e291d8 OP_EQUAL
address
3JtqTJmLXB5YtMz5oH2ZR6DMSKnBtofqct
transaction
57c46941f81c46a0f1519cff5243c61eb252e91e5dd78a5d54dfbac3304e86ba
spent
true